VAUXHALL GARDENS, North Shore. npHE Proprietors of these beautiful -»~ Grounds beg to thank their numerous friend for past favours, and to intimate that the grounds will be again opened for the season on the Anniversary of tho Prince of Wales Birthday. To those of our friends who have visited them no description is necessary. We have only to say that improvements have been made ; and to those who have not visited them we think one visit will prove to them that for Pleasure-seekers theso grounds afford every facility for gratification. There are Flowers in profusion, pleasant Arbors, Shady Walks, Lawn for a Dance, Croquet, Swings ; and for the masculine a game at Quoits, for which ground has boon prepared specially. Strawberries and Cream with other refreshment to bo had. The Proprietors beg to Intimate that they will have a Marquee on the outer beach, in which to supply Strawberries and Cream. A Band will perform on Saturday Afternoons. W. WELLS & SONS, PROPRIETORS. gT X AWBEBEIES STRAWBERRIES AND CREAM. WILLOW GROVE, NORT*i SHORE, ON BEACH ROAD, Within a Hundred Yards of tho Lower Wharf.
